3.5 for me. A little bit of mixed feelings. Parts 1 & 3 were great, but I did not enjoy the triplets' college years in Part 2. Such great family drama starting from the very beginning and some very interesting characters (Harrison!). Phoebe was such a great character/"latecomer" and I really liked her being the main character in Part 3.

I think the author did a great job tying in 9/11 but not making it a huge plot point. So many topics and emotions in this book covering adultery, death/grieving, growing up, sibling dynamics and so much more.
